University of Delaware is a large four-year university in the large suburb of Newark, DE.
The school is on the four-one-four plan calendar system and is a research university with very high research activity.
There are 19,554 undergraduate students and 4,126 graduate students at University of Delaware.
The freshman class has 3,746 students.
Students attend full-time.
